N529RK is a Piper Aero Star, a twin-engine piston aircraft operated by RHK OF KANSAS INC. SkyMeter has tracked 14 flights totalling 15 hours of airtime via ADS-B. The most frequent segment is KJEF to KSGS. Service window in our records spans 90 days. The Piper Aero Star has a 37 ft wingspan, a maximum takeoff weight of 6,315 lb.
